Problem

Existing capacitance detection technologies face challenges in sensitivity and accuracy due to low-frequency interference signals, which affect the accurate determination of user interactions in electronic devices.

Innovation Solution

A capacitance detection circuit comprising a drive module, conversion module, and control module, where the conversion module includes a suppression module that filters out interference signals with frequencies below or above a certain threshold, enhancing the sensitivity and accuracy of capacitance detection by generating an output voltage while suppressing unwanted signals.

AI summary

A capacitance detection circuit, a detection chip, and an electronic device are provided. The circuit includes: a first drive module, a conversion module, a processing module, and a control module. The first drive module is configured to charge a first capacitor to be detected. The conversion module is configured to perform charge conversion processing on the first capacitor to be detected to generate an output voltage. The control module is configured to control a first suppression module of the conversion module to suppress an interference signal with a frequency less than a first frequency or greater than a second frequency when the conversion module generates the output voltage, and the second frequency is greater than the first frequency. The processing module is configured to determine a capacitance change before and after the first capacitor to be detected is affected by an applied electric field based on the output voltage.
